WebSep 1, 2024 · While approximately 15% of global land is protected, India officially protects 5% of its area (Dinerstein et al., 2024). However, India's conservation challenge differs from that of other large countries, such as the USA, Brazil, and China. Impacts of Land Use Change on Biodiversity. The BII for India in the year 2010 is 41.67%. Changes of BII in our scenarios are driven by the conversion of natural and set-aside land to cropland, pasture, and urban area as well as by the intensification ...

WebIndia is one of these megadiverse countries with 2.4% of the land area, accounting for 7-8% of the species of the world, including about 91,000 species of animals and 45,500 species of plants, that have been documented in its ten bio-geographic regions.
